经常有朋友问孩子要不要学编程?孩子要不要学编程已经是一个老生常谈的话题了,那么除了正向思考孩子为什么要学编程之外,我们可以换个角度想想,编程给我们带来了什么?孩子学习了编程之后又能做什么呢?孩子学编程怎样开始?有什么好的少儿编程软件?
今天来和大家分享一些很特别的编程软件,能帮孩子以有趣的方式了解和尝试编程。如果真的有兴趣和才能,早点开始会不会孕育未来伟大的发明和创造?
1、慧编程(mblock 5) https://www.makeblock.com.cn/cn/software/mblock5
慧编程是一款面向STEAM教育领域的积木式编程和代码编程软件,基于Scratch 3.0开发,近400万用户用它创造、学习和分享。它不仅能让用户在软件中创作有趣的故事、游戏、动画等,还能对Makeblock体系、micro:bit等硬件进行编程。
慧编程支持一键切换Python等代码语言,提供Python输入模式,同时融入AI(人工智能)和IoT(物联网)等前沿技术。
使用慧编程,编程成果 可通过现实世界的声光电和有趣互动直观呈现,让编程更有趣味性,培养孩子的学习兴趣。
2、Scratch
Scratch是一款由麻省理工学院(MIT) 设计开发的一款面向少年的简易编程工具。在2012年在中国得到普及,2013预计在上海举行比赛。针对 8 岁以上孩子们的认知水平,以及对于界面的喜好,MIT 做了相当深入研究和颇具针对性的设计开发。不仅易于孩子们使用,又能寓教于乐,让孩子们获得创作中的乐趣。
3、Blockly
Blockly其实是Google在Scratch上的改进版,编程原理也是积木模块来实现编程。不同的是,Blockly支持更多类型的编码。包括JavasScript,Python,PHP,Lua和Dart。所以,其他编程零基础的人也可以通过这款软件入门。
4、Swift Playgrounds
Swift是苹果发布的新开发语言,旨在教孩子们如何在Swift中进行编程。这款游戏可以从苹果商店免费下载,适用于零基础编程人员。
家长们可以根据孩子的年龄特点选择适合孩子的启蒙工具和语言,可以的话,家长和孩子共同学习,这样就能在孩子学习的过程中做出适当的指引。
推荐家长选择慧编程软件,并且让孩子结合makeblock机器人进行编程学习,这样编程成果可通过makeblock机器人有趣互动直观呈现,让编程更有趣味性,培养孩子的学习兴趣。
点击了解适合用于编程学习的教育机器人